Neuberger Berman = $12.277m

September 25, 2010 by Marion Maneker

Sotheby’s sold 83% of the 142 lots offered from the Neuberger Berman collection. The 118 lots that sold produced a number of artist records for the young talents with thinly traded markets. At least Five of the top 10 works went to collectors — there might have been more because the remainder preferred to be anonymous — suggesting that there is still a strong body of Contemporary art collectors chasing new art. (Few experts would have claimed that there was A+ work in the sale. That isn’t a slap at Neuberger’s curators.) (results on full post)
